JUST-IN: Bandits, illegal Miners Clash In Kaduna, Left 7 Dead

Kindly Share This Story:

A clash between suspected bandits and a group of illegal miners in Kuyello Ward, Birnin Gwari Local Government Area of Kaduna State left about seven people dead.

A source told DAILY POST that the incident took place around 11am, which brought panic among the residents as gunshots echoed across the area and forced residents to flee into the surrounding bushes for safety.

The area is known to host notorious bandits for illegal mining that have long caused security risk in the region.

Trouble started, according to the source, after a suspected bandit demanded levies from illegal miners operating in the area, causing a dispute that led to his death.

The slain bandit was said to have arrived from neighbouring Zamfara State to extort money from the miners as usual but the encounter claimed his life.

He explained, “The death of the bandit led to an invasion by his gang members in Kuyello, in broad daylight. They started shooting indiscriminately leading to the death of seven people, including some of the miners.”

The attack brought an end to the fragile calm the community had enjoyed for about a year in parts of Birnin Gwari following the Kaduna State Government’s peace-building initiatives.

He lamented that the illegal mining had become a serious problem to the people and became a “curse” for the people of Birnin Gwari.

He pleaded with the government to stop the illegal miners, saying that they were the reason the bandits keep returning, resulting in fights over money or gold, causing innocent people to suffer.

The source explained that following the incident, security personnel had been deployed to the area to prevent further violence.

Mansir Hassan, the state police command spokesman, could not comment on the incident as calls to his phone were not answered.
